Output 17e420ca59c00fb3588195d51e0d974377572f5c77a9da3ca92319ebf4f655f0:0

value
3096317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78cf640aca58ef976f656f7d4d042560caaa6281 OP_EQUAL
address
3ChoTKywn8UNkEfcEovzg1r3ZaegeTk3hB
transaction
17e420ca59c00fb3588195d51e0d974377572f5c77a9da3ca92319ebf4f655f0
spent
true